Output 15ada623d687337256ab63e4cd98bfdafff08542ebb9f3d2b455d01b7c907916:0

value
531275108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c67515cad4fbe45a326775b62f9a53b4a1e292c OP_EQUAL
address
MSXwrDE6DFZGWbbuAizNYr2s1Sbw3Kr19t
transaction
15ada623d687337256ab63e4cd98bfdafff08542ebb9f3d2b455d01b7c907916
spent
true